About the Board

The Town of Franklinton operates under the Council/Manager form of government. The Town Board is a non-partisan Board consisting of a Mayor and five Commissioners who are elected to four year terms. The Mayor presides at all meetings and only votes in the event of a tie vote.

As the legislative body of the Town, the Board of Commissioners adopts ordinances and resolutions and establishes policies, programs and procedures necessary for governing Franklinton.

The Board of Commissioners also appoints a Town Attorney who gives legal advice to the Town and a Town Manager who is the Chief Administrator. The Town Manager is responsible for preparing the budget and administering it in accordance with the Board's direction. The Town Manager supervises all departments and functions of the Town of Franklinton.
